Output f84a9531cc5ad237e4f242c65fbd66205d48665535dc0e52f66c57d541422b77:5

value
3138000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54c1fcde091cdaf8641c1dfaafb13f1b46752328 OP_EQUAL
address
39RB5ASXJ7wTeDWMEYX5Q67JVccpJAu8A6
transaction
f84a9531cc5ad237e4f242c65fbd66205d48665535dc0e52f66c57d541422b77
confirmations
137654
spent
true